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,997 per month in Charlottetown vs $1,682 in Mexico City, rent included.

A couple spends around $2,969 per month in Charlottetown vs $2,599 in Mexico City, rent included.

A family of three spends $3,941 per month in Charlottetown vs $3,516 in Mexico City, rent included.

Charlottetown costs about 19% more than Mexico City,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both Charlottetown and Mexico City sit above the global median – Charlottetown by 46%, Mexico City by 23%.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$1,116 in Charlottetown versus $1,147 in Mexico City.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 132% higher in Charlottetown,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$62.0 in Charlottetown versus $52.0 in Mexico City.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$424 vs $344 – making Mexico City the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
